Update on previous post.
Ordered F62 yesterday afternoon from Samsung Shop app. Received msg on whatsapp at 4pm of it being packed. At 8 pm it had been shipped with delivery date of 25 Feb. Today morning at 9am got call from delivery agent and pleasantly phone was delivered so early. Excellent service all around from Samsung shop app and I am glad i didn't ordered from flipkart.

Took me around 3 hours to switch all data from A50 and set it up fully. Initial impressions-

1. Gorgeous display. I can say atleast 30% improvement over A50 display which is Amoled too. 60Hz don't feel like a disadvantage due to snappy processor and beautiful display.

2. No lag even when I had opened atleast 40 apps simultaneously.

3. Very good camera so far. Big improvement over A50.

4. Very good battery life. Even at 75% brightness will easily get 7 hours minimum screen on time.

5. Android 11 and One UI 3.1 are a delight to use.

I had tried M51 at Croma earlier and F62 is much better in all departments.

FYI, if anyone orders it, do order the case online itself as offline accessories for this phone aren't available right now.
